Southside’s Ryals wins state Bryant-Jordan award

By Chris McCarthy/Editor

Not many high school student-athletes go from undergoing head major surgery to winning four straight state wrestling titles.

In recognition of the above accomplishment, Southside High senior Haden Ryals was named the Class 5A overall state winner of the 2014 Bryant-Jordan Scholarship Award for Student Achievement on Monday in Birmingham,.

Southside shuts out Sardis to win county baseball championship

By Gene Stanley/Sports Correspondent

Southside High made no bones about who was to be crowned county baseball champion, as the No. 4 Panthers bested Sardis, 9-0, in the championship game on Saturday (Apr. 12) at SHS.

Clifton resigns as Coosa Christian football coach

By Chris McCarthy/Editor

Scott Clifton is one-and-done with the Conquerors.

Last week, the Coosa Christian head football coach resigned after one season in Gadsden.

Clifton, who guided the 2013 Conquerors to a 3-7 record last season that included a 3-1finish, said that the decision to step down was his.
